found some options... (btw vmsg and vmg are the same afaik just the different ending)

1. the app on the play store vmg converter
2. if you have one vmsg file with all sms first split the file with "gsplit" with splitting the file every 1 times (or maybe it was 2 because of the first sms...?!?) BEFORE "BEGIN:VMSG" so every file starts with a non empty first line then use "ABC amber nokia converter" and save as you like... then you can import it with some tools from the play store ;) if you have duplicate sms like me you can use AllDup before using ABC amber to delete the double sms
3. on the net there were also some intelligent python or whatever scripts to convert the files but im not very familiar with python...
